Well-known sex therapist Westheimer here presents a provocative, richly eclectic, inspirational collection of erotic art. Chapters proceed methodically from flirtation and seduction to foreplay, the embrace, solitary and group pleasures and conclude with blissful exhaustion--a loose framework for organizing more than 100 color reproductions of works by Georgia O'Keeffe, Titian, Watteau, Durer, Manet, Courbet, Egon Schiele, David Hockney and others.
The Art of Arousal: A Celebration of Erotic Art throughout History
The scope is multicultural, embracing Persian miniatures, a Cambodian sandstone female torso, a Dogon primordial couple from west Africa and Hopi carver Fred Koruh's interlocking male and female kachina dolls. Westheimer's exhortatory interjections on foreplay, lovemaking positions and so forth seem intrusive amidst the shrewd art-historical commentaries of her anonymous, albeit acknowledged cultural adviser. Overall, this is a delightful bedside companion.

Austrian Expressionist Egon Schiele produced a prolific body of work before his early death at the age of twenty-eight in 1918. The oeuvre is comprised of a few hundred oil paintings and thousands of drawings and watercolors.
Schiele's oils have often been reproduced and are well recognized. However, limited access to the fragile works on paper and dispersion among several collections have made for an unbalanced representation of his work as a draftsman.

"Hindering the artist is a crime," wrote Egon Schiele in 1912. At the time he was in prison for disseminating immoral drawings. Throughout his work the note of defiance, provocation, and rebellion was sounded. Schiele's favorite subjects were female nudes and self-portraits, and he worked at his art with furious commitment, though it was not until shortly before his early death that he began to win real recognition. Today, with Oskar Kokoschka, he is seen as the most important of the Austrian artists who came after Klimt. This study examines the life and work of Egon Schiele through all the major oil paintings and many of his erotic drawings.

Egon Schiele is known for being grotesque, erotic, pornographic, and disturbing, focusing on sex, death, and discovery. He focused on portraits of others as well as himself. In his later years, while he still worked often with nudes, they were done in a more realist fashion. He also painted tributes to Van Gogh's Sunflowers as well as landscapes and still lifes.
